The video explores two transformative theater models: Jerzy Grotowski's Poor Theater and Augusto Boal's Theater of the Oppressed. Grotowski's approach focuses on personal discovery, eliminating theatrical conventions to emphasize the actor's role. Boal's method aims for social change, involving the audience as 'spect-actors' to address social issues. Both models challenge traditional theater norms, seeking deeper connections between actors and audiences. The video concludes by comparing their distinct goals: Grotowski's pursuit of self-knowledge and Boal's quest for social justice.
